The ancient city of Sousse was built in the 9th century BC by the Phoenicians. The lively city was under the rule of Punic, Romans and finally the Muslims. Sousse has successfully retained its original character that is evident from the monuments, museums and buildings dotted around the city. The place is renowned for its scenic beaches, striking medina and restaurants that serve wide variety of seafood.

The old city area called Medina is popular amongst tourists, housing several shop that sell carpets, silver jewelry, woolen blankets and copper items. The Great Mosque of Sousse was built in the 9th century is a major tourist attraction and is renowned for its unique architecture. Besides this, other important tourist attractions in Sousse include The Kasbah, Archeological Museum, Museum of Kalaout el-Koubba and Zaouia Zakkak.
